Summary
This 8-K filing from Abbott Laboratories, dated April 6, 2004, announces a change in its business segment reporting, effective January 1, 2004. These adjustments are primarily driven by shifts in reporting responsibilities for certain products previously under U.S. Hospital Products Sales, anticipating a future spin-off of a significant portion of this business into a new entity, Hospira. The reclassifications aim to better reflect the operational structure and will impact how sales are reported across U.S. Pharmaceutical Sales, U.S. Hospital Products Sales, and a new 'Other Sales' category which will include Abbott Vascular Devices and Spinal Concepts. Investors should note that while the total sales remain consistent, the allocation across segments is changing. Notably, proprietary hospital pharmaceuticals and vitamin D therapy are moving to U.S. Pharmaceutical Sales, while vascular and spinal device businesses are shifting to 'Other Sales.' This restructuring is a precursor to the anticipated spin-off of Hospira, which will house the major operating component of the former U.S. Hospital Products Sales. The company intends to provide a final segment reporting structure update via a future 8-K filing post-spin-off.
